TWO brutes who used crowbars when they raided two off-licences on the same day have been handed lengthy jail terms.
Alun Rowe and Alan Mark Killen, both from Liverpool, robbed two Parr stores on April 14.
In the raids - at Shaun's Off-Licence, Chancery Lane and then the Co-op Late Shop, Ashtons Green Drive - they threatened staff with crowbars. The owner of Shaun's was struck by the metal bar.
Rowe, 33, from Kingsheath Avenue, Liverpool 14, and Killen, 39, from Portelet Road, Liverpool 13, were both arrested on the evening of the offences.
They were found guilty at Liverpool Crown Court. Rowe was sentenced to eight years in prison and Killen for 10 years.
